WebbCoughing up blood (hemoptysis) isn’t the same as vomiting blood (hematemesis). Blood that’s coughed up usually looks like blood-stained spit mixed with mucus. The blood comes from your throat or mouth. Vomiting blood involves spewing large quantities of blood.
